Functionalizer

Latest version: v1.0.0

Safety actively analyzes 706267 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 6 of 8

0.13.2

==============

Changes:
- Ensure that properties drawn from a truncated gaussian are always
positive: truncate the normal distribution at ±1σ and 0.

0.13.1

==============

Changes:
- Fix random number generation for determining active connections

==============

Changes:
- Support post- and pre- neuron ordering of the output.
- Reordering of the command line options and help

0.12.1

==============

Changes:
- Fix the morphology output to use floats consistently
- Add ability to process morphologies stored in nested directories

0.12.0

==============

Changes:
- Switched to new unique seeding for random numbers: **breaks
backwards-compatibility on a bitwise comparison**
- Improved `gap-junctions` support:
* unique junction ID ready to consume by Neurodamus
* added bi-directionality to dendro-somatic touches

0.11.0

==============

Changes:
- Initial support for gap-junctions
- Control filters run with `--filters` command-line option
- One of `--structural`, `--functional`, or `--gap-junctions` has to be
passed to the executable to define filters
- Save neuron ids as 64 bit integers in the final export
- Add the following information to `report.json`:
* the largest shuffle size
* the number of rows seen last
* the largest number of rows seen
- Documented filters

0.10.3

==============

Changes:
- Read the layers from circuit files rather than inferring them from
morphologies

Page 6 of 8

© 2025 Safety CLI Cybersecurity Inc. All Rights Reserved.